Bloomfield
Bloomfield is a little village with a big place in people’s hearts. The town is ideally situated in the centre of The County. Entrepreneurial farmers settled the area in the late 1700s, and there are still working farms right in town. Because of this history, restaurants and cafés serve up fresh, local ingredients – some coming from just down the road.
Bloomfield’s main stretch has quirky boutiques featuring clothing, accessories, home and kitchen products and lots of County-made finds. You can rent a bicycle and ride to nearby galleries and antique emporiums or simply cruise past stunning Loyalist architecture. Bloomfield is a great jumping off point for a ride on the Millennium Trail. The area has been welcoming guests for some 200 years – so you know the local accommodations won’t disappoint.
